Understanding Digital Fundraising Tools

In the digital age, fundraising for charities has evolved beyond traditional methods to include a wide array of online tools and platforms. These digital fundraising tools offer an efficient way to reach a broader audience, engage with donors, and maximize your organization's impact. Understanding these tools is the first step towards leveraging them effectively.

Digital fundraising encompasses various technologies, including crowdfunding platforms, social media campaigns, and donation processing software. Each tool serves a unique purpose and can be tailored to meet the specific needs of your charity. By integrating these tools into your strategy, you can streamline your operations and enhance donor engagement.

Selecting the Right Platforms

Choosing the right digital fundraising platforms is crucial to your charity's success. Not all platforms are created equal, and selecting one that aligns with your organization's goals and target audience can make a significant difference. Start by identifying your fundraising objectives and the type of campaigns you wish to run.

Crowdfunding platforms like GoFundMe or Kickstarter are ideal for project-based fundraising, while social media platforms such as Facebook and Instagram can be powerful for reaching a younger, tech-savvy audience. Consider the user experience, fees, and the tools each platform offers to maximize your impact.

Engaging Your Donors

Engagement is a key factor in successful digital fundraising. By connecting with donors on a personal level, you can build lasting relationships that encourage continued support. Utilize email campaigns, newsletters, and social media interactions to keep donors informed and engaged with your cause.

Storytelling is a powerful tool in this regard. Share stories of those who have benefited from your charity's work to create an emotional connection with your audience. This approach not only humanizes your efforts but also motivates donors to contribute more generously.

Optimizing Your Campaigns

To maximize the impact of your digital fundraising efforts, it's essential to continually assess and optimize your campaigns. Use analytics tools to track the performance of your campaigns and identify areas for improvement. Key metrics such as conversion rates, average donation size, and donor retention rates can provide valuable insights.

Experiment with different content types, messaging strategies, and visuals to see what resonates best with your audience. A/B testing can be particularly useful in determining the most effective approaches for your campaigns.

Utilizing Data for Strategic Decisions

Data plays a critical role in shaping the strategies of successful digital fundraising campaigns. By leveraging data analytics, you can make informed decisions that enhance the effectiveness of your efforts. Analyze donor demographics, campaign performance, and donation patterns to gain deeper insights into donor behavior.

Utilize this data to personalize donor experiences and tailor your messaging to align with their interests and preferences. Personalized experiences often lead to higher engagement rates and increased donations.

Embracing Mobile Donations

As mobile device usage continues to rise, embracing mobile-friendly donation options is crucial for reaching donors on their preferred devices. Ensure that your website is mobile-optimized and that the donation process is seamless and easy to navigate on smartphones and tablets.

Consider implementing mobile payment options such as Apple Pay or Google Wallet to facilitate quick and convenient donations. A mobile-friendly approach not only enhances user experience but also increases the likelihood of spontaneous donations.

Building a Strong Online Presence

A strong online presence is vital for maximizing the impact of your digital fundraising efforts. This includes maintaining an active website and engaging social media profiles that effectively communicate your charity’s mission and impact.

Regularly update your online platforms with fresh content, success stories, and upcoming events to keep supporters informed and engaged. An active online presence helps build trust and credibility with potential donors.
